A full guided tour of ‪@IrishFerries‬ new super ferry Oscar Wilde which operates the service between Pembroke Dock #wales and Rosslare Europort #ireland.
An extremely fast vessel, she makes the Irish Sea crossing in around 3.5hrs
Onboard one will find a mamouth 17,000 Square foot shopping mall (the largest found on any Irish Sea ferry), the Sea Pub, Boylan's Brasserie, Café LaFayette, Adventure Island children's playroom, a Club Class lounge overlooking the ships' bow and superb terraced stern exterior decks.

    Tonnage 36,249 GT 3,500 DWT Length 186.00 m (610 ft 3 in) Beam 27.70 m (90 ft 11 in) Draught 6.50 m (21 ft 4 in) Ice class 1 A Super Propulsion 4 × MaK diesels combined 48,000 kW (64,000 hp) Speed 27 kn (50.0 km/h; 31.1 mph) Capacity 2,080 passengers 134 cabins 520 passenger beds 450 cars 2,380 lanemeters
